pxa2xx_udc: cleanups, use platform_get_irq

Make the pxa2xx_udc driver fetch its IRQ from platform resources
rather than using compile-time constants, so that it works properly
on IXP4xx systems not just PXA21x/25x/26x.


Other updates:
 - Do that using platform_get_irq()
 - Switch to platform_driver_probe()
 - Handle device_add() errors
 - Remove "function" sysfs attribute and its potential errors
 - Whitespace cleanups
